Exercise 4: Abandoned Cart Sequence
Write your three-stage abandoned cart flow:
-
Stage 1 (1 hour): Gentle reminder
-
Stage 2 (24 hours): Incentive offer
-
Stage 3 (48 hours): Final follow-up
Include specific details: product mentions, links, codes, and time limits.
Exercise 5: Handoff Script
Write the exact message your bot sends when transferring to a human agent. Include:
-
Thank you for your patience
-
Agent name and expertise
-
Confirmation that context is shared
-
Expected wait time
